
This patch modifies the usb_device_info() function to enumerate active USB hubs by iterating UCLASS_USB_HUB directly.
The previous code used UCLASS_USB nodes instead and retrieved their first child node, expecting it to be a hub. However, it did not protect against retrieving (and dereferencing) a NULL pointer this way.
Depending on the available USB hardware, this might happen easily. For example the USB controller on sun7i-a20 has top-level OHCI nodes that won't have any children as long as no USB1-only peripheral is attached. ("usb tree" will only show EHCI nodes.)
The failure can also be demonstrated with U-Boot's sandbox architecture, by simply enabling the inactive "usb_2" node in test.dts. This creates a similar situation, where the existing usb_device_info() implementation would crash (segfault) when issuing a "usb info" command.
